Job Description

  • Position Type: Full-time, Hourly, Non-Exempt
  • Reports To: Project Manager
  • Salary Range: $25.00 – $50.00 per hour, commensurate with experience
  • Client Overview

    The Source and Recruit Company has been retained by a well-established, employee-owned mechanical services organization to assist with the recruitment of an HVAC Service Technician. This organization is recognized as a leading provider of residential and commercial plumbing, heating, air conditioning, and sheet metal services within its region. As an employee-owned company, team members have the opportunity to share in the long-term success of the business while working in a stable, year-round environment supported by a strong safety culture and commitment to quality.

    Role Overview

    The HVAC Service Technician will play a key role in delivering reliable, high-quality service to residential and commercial customers. This position is well-suited for a skilled technician who values craftsmanship, takes pride in doing the job right the first time, and enjoys working both independently and as part of a collaborative team. The role offers consistent work, professional development opportunities, and the chance to contribute to a company where employee ownership is central to its culture.

    Key Responsibilities

    • Troubleshoot, repair, replace, and maintain plumbing, heating, and air conditioning systems
    • Apply knowledge of applicable HVAC and plumbing codes to ensure compliance and quality standards
    • Complete work with strong attention to detail and a focus on long-term system performance
    • Work independently in the field while collaborating effectively with internal teams
    • Represent the organization professionally when interacting with customers and partners
    • Commit to a minimum of 40 hours per week, with overtime opportunities available
    • Participate in an on-call rotation during peak heating season (October through April), with summers off from on-call duty

    Qualifications

    • Experience and certifications in one or more of the following areas: Gas, Plumbing, and/or Refrigeration
    • Ability to pass a clean driver’s license and criminal background check
    • Physical ability to sit, stand, walk, bend, and work in varied conditions for extended periods
    • Ability to lift, carry, push, and pull up to 50 pounds
    • Demonstrated commitment to workplace safety and best practices
    • Strong desire to learn, grow professionally, and contribute to team success

    Benefits

    • Competitive hourly compensation based on experience
    • Generous paid time off, including vacation, sick time, and paid holidays
    • Comprehensive health insurance options, including PPO and High Deductible Health Plans with HSA
    • Dental and vision insurance
    • Company-paid life insurance, short-term disability, and long-term disability coverage
    • 401(k) retirement plan
    • Employee Stock Ownership Plan (ESOP) eligibility after the waiting period
    • Ongoing training and professional development opportunities
    • Company-provided uniforms
